Yuliana 5.0 wins New Engines Tournament, by Chess Engines Diary 28.07.2024
https://chessengines.blogspot.com/2024/ ... ament.html
As many as 33 chess engines and over 1000 games were played in the next test tournament. The winner was the Yuliana 5.0 engine (currently available only to our testers). Places 2-3 were shared by the Stockfish dev-20240723 and Stockfish 16.1 engines. More tests soon, we are also preparing a new ranking list for August 1, 2024.

Kookaburra 3.00 wins Strong Engines Tournament (Tests by Jörn Gronemann, Heide, 2024.07.30)
https://chessengines.blogspot.com/2024/ ... gines.html
Very large test tournament - 1200 games won by the Kookaburra 3.00 chess engine. In 2nd place for the JigSaw 5.9 engine. 3rd place for the Marauders 3.6 chess engine.

Berserk 13 wins Middle Class Engines Tournament (Tests by Jörn Gronemann, 2024.08.01)
https://chessengines.blogspot.com/2024/ ... gines.html
Very large test tournament (1320 games) of mid-class chess engines. Berserk 13 won with a very large advantage. In 2nd place the PlentyChess 3.0.0-dev engine and 3rd place for the Caissa 1.20 engine.

Stockfish 16.1 wins New Engines Test, by Chess Engines Diary, 2024.08.03
https://chessengines.blogspot.com/2024/ ... st-by.html
A large tournament of new versions of chess engines (nearly 1000 games) was won by... Stockfish 16.1. As it turned out, the official version of this engine was a strict examiner. Places 2 to 5 were taken by ShashChess 35.3, Cool Iris 12.10, Yuliana 5.0 and Stockfish 20240723 Ivec.

HypnoS 20240727 wins New Strong Engines Test, by CEDR 03.08.2024
https://chessengines.blogspot.com/2024/ ... gines.html
A small tournament of new versions of chess engines was won by HypnoS 20240727. On places 2-4 engines Clover 7.0, Yuliana 5.0 and Stockfish 20240723 Ivec. The good result of the Clover engine is surprising - as many as 8 victories, although one defeat.
